In this week's episode of The Life of a Bon Vivant, Beeta sits down with tax attorney Jonathan Hadida to demystify the complexities of expat taxes particularly for Americans looking to move to or retire in France. Jonathan, founder of Had Tax, shares invaluable insights on how the US-French tax treaty benefits retirees, debunks the myth of a 70% tax rate, and explains why France could actually be a tax haven for American expats. If you’ve ever wondered how your pension, Social Security, or investment income would be taxed abroad, this episode is a must-listen!

In this week's episode of The Life of a Bon Vivant podcast, Beeta shares her experience and insights on finding a place to live in Paris, offering valuable tips for navigating the competitive rental market and the complexities of buying property as a foreigner. Prompted by a listener's question about her own apartment search, Beeta explores what to consider when renting or buying, from understanding Paris's unique neighborhoods to managing landlord expectations. Whether you're dreaming of retiring in France, planning a move, or simply curious about the Parisian real estate scene, this episode is filled with practical insights and relatable stories to guide your apartment hunt.
Start your apartment search on:
Seloger.fr
Pap.fr
LeBonCoin.fr
Jinka.fr
